The Criticisms of Body Positivity as a Social Trend

Some critics argue that body positivity has become a trend that is used to sell products and perpetuate certain beauty standards. They suggest that the movement has been co-opted by companies who use body positive messaging to sell clothing and beauty products, without actually addressing the underlying issues of body shaming and discrimination.

Furthermore, some argue that the focus on individual body positivity can detract from the systemic issues that contribute to body shame and discrimination. By placing the onus on individuals to love their bodies, rather than addressing the societal and cultural factors that contribute to body shame, the movement may inadvertently reinforce the status quo.

Additionally, some critics argue that the body positive movement has been co-opted by privileged groups, such as white, thin, and able-bodied individuals, who are able to participate in the movement without facing the same level of discrimination and oppression as other groups. This has led to accusations of tokenism and cultural appropriation, and has further perpetuated the marginalization of already marginalized groups.

Finally, some critics argue that the body positive movement has been overly focused on physical appearance, rather than addressing broader issues of health and wellness. By focusing solely on body positivity, some argue that the movement has neglected the importance of mental health, nutrition, and physical activity, and has perpetuated harmful beauty standards that prioritize appearance over health.

Overall, while the body positive movement has brought much-needed attention to issues of body shame and discrimination, it is important to be mindful of the potential pitfalls and criticisms of the movement, and to ensure that it remains a truly inclusive and transformative force for change.

The Complexities of Body Positivity

While body positivity has brought much-needed attention to the importance of self-acceptance and body diversity, it is not without its complexities.

Differing Interpretations

One of the challenges of body positivity is the differing interpretations of what it means. Some see it as a movement towards self-love and acceptance, while others view it as a means to promote physical diversity. These varying perspectives can lead to confusion and conflict within the movement.

Commercialization

Another complexity of body positivity is its commercialization. The movement has been co-opted by the fashion and beauty industries, which often use body positivity as a marketing tool to sell products. This can be problematic as it perpetuates the idea that physical appearance is the most important aspect of self-worth.

Privilege and Oppression

Body positivity also raises questions about privilege and oppression. The movement often centers around those who have the most social capital, such as white, thin, able-bodied individuals. This can leave out those who are marginalized and face discrimination based on their body size, race, ability, and other factors.

Individual vs. Systemic Change

There is also a debate within the body positivity movement about whether it should focus on individual change or systemic change. Some argue that self-love and acceptance should be the primary focus, while others believe that structural changes are necessary to create a more equitable society.
